Padmini and A.S.A.Sami appeared together in 3 Tamil films between 1961 and 1971. Their highest-rated collaboration was Thirumagal (1971 — 7.3/10). Films span Arasilangkumari (1961) through Thirumagal (1971).

Partnership facts
- Sami was a top stunt choreographer before he turned actor. He personally trained Padmini for the sword fights in Arasilangkumari (1961). That film was their first together, and he literally taught her how to hold a weapon on screen.
- In Veeranganai (1964), Sami did all his own stunts — no doubles. Padmini matched him beat for beat in the action sequences. She later said he pushed her to do physically demanding scenes she never attempted with other co-stars.
- Padmini and Sami were close friends off-screen. She often called him 'Anna' (elder brother). After Thirumagal (1971), they never worked together again — but she remained in touch with his family for decades.
- Thirumagal (1971) was a remake of a Malayalam hit. But Padmini and Sami's version became the template for Tamil devotional family dramas that followed — films like Sampoorna Ramayanam borrowed its emotional tone.
- Padmini once told a magazine: 'Sami anna never let me feel like a heroine who needed protection. He made me fight like a warrior.' She said this in a 1972 interview about Veeranganai.

Where each was in their career
Before Arasilangkumari, Padmini had starred in 7 films, including Vidivelli (1960) and Deivapiravi (1960).
After Thirumagal, Padmini went on to appear in 11 more films, including Uzhaikkum Karangal (1976) and Poove Poochooda Vaa (1985).
Before Arasilangkumari, A.S.A.Sami had directed 1 film, including Kaithi Kannayiram (1960).
